AP Type Motor-Driven Grease Pump

The AP Type Motor-Driven Grease Pump is the vehicle-supply pump in the grease range, running at DC 12 V or 24 V for automotive chassis and engineering machinery. Discharge is 260 ml/min from a 3 L polycarbonate reservoir, and the pump is ordered with or without a pressure take-off device.
How it works
Designed for automotive chassis (buses, trucks, trailers) and for engineering machinery, running directly off vehicle supply at DC 12 V or 24 V. Rated output pressure is 3.8 MPa, which is the ceiling of the low pressure class.
With a pressure take-off device fitted, the AP drives AD volumetric, RH-3 and 35 type distributors, dosing a stated volume to each point per cycle. Without one, it drives U type and SD progressive distributors, feeding the points in strict sequence.
Both circuits are common on vehicles and the take-off device is fitted at manufacture, so the circuit type has to be stated on the order.

Installation notes
Because the AP runs off the vehicle's own DC 12 V or 24 V supply, fitting it is a wiring tap into the chassis electrics rather than a plant power run. Confirm which voltage the chassis carries before ordering. The pressure take-off device that lets the pump cycle a volumetric distributor is fitted at manufacture and is not a field-retrofit part, so state at order time whether the circuit is volumetric (AD, RH-3 or 35 type) or progressive (U type or SD distributor, pump without the take-off device).
Before you order
- 3.8 MPa maximum. Do not specify an AP for a progressive circuit that needs high pressure at the point. That is a ZJ application.
- NLGI 000# to 0# grease only. A stiffer grade will not draw down the 3 L reservoir reliably on vehicle supply.

Frequently asked questions
Can I switch the AP between a volumetric and progressive circuit after it arrives?
No. The pressure take-off device is fitted at manufacture, so the circuit type has to be stated on the order, not decided once the pump is in hand.
What grease does the AP pump take?
NLGI 000# to 0#. A stiffer grade will not draw down the 3 L reservoir reliably on vehicle supply.
What voltage does the AP run on?
DC 12 V or 24 V, taken directly from the vehicle's own supply.
